Objectives
The excitation balancer should be used in combination with the following objectives. Use of other objectives may result
in unevenness in the field of view.
Plan fluor 40x/0.75 40xH/1.3 100xH/1.3
S fluor 40x/0.9 40xH/1.3 100xH/1.3
Plan apochromat 40x/0.95 60xH/1.4 100xH/1.4

Switching the Excitation Filter (Motorized Excitation Filter Wheel)
By attaching a motorized excitation filter wheel between the
epi-fluorescence attachment and the HG precentered fiber
illuminator, switching of the excitation filters can be motorized.
Up to 8 filters can be attached to the wheel.
A reflective ND filter can be attached to each excitation filter.
See Chapter 1 “3 Assembly Method - 13 Attach the motorized
excitation filter wheel” in the “Assembly/Maintenance” instruction
manual for attaching the excitation filter.
Configure the information on attaching the excitation filter to the
wheel on DS-L3. (See “23 Operation on DS-L3” - “23.1 Setting
Up the Microscope - (1) Setting Optical Elements Installation
Information” for details.)
The wheel is rotated by the FUNCTION button on the Ni-E
microscope main body. Press FUNCTION button 3 or 4 to rotate
the wheel counterclockwise or clockwise and change the wheel
address one by one. An excitation filter indicated on the display
panel on the front of the Ni-E microscope is brought into the
optical path.
